## Tuning

FeeCrafter's rules engine decides shipping fees per order, and yes, the defaults are opinionated. If a merchant on the Parcelgrove plan complains about weird surcharges, it's almost always one of the knobs below rather than a bug. Changing a value takes effect on the next rule reload, so no restart needed — just don't crank the distance multiplier without checking with eng. Current defaults follow.

tuning table, kageg-kagap:
CAPS = {
    "druox": 842,
    "quenax": 605,
    "zormir": 107,
    "tamwyn": 577,
    "kasok": 688,
}

Subject: Winding down the Larkspur line

Hi all — and a warm welcome to our incoming director. As flagged at the offsite, we're moving ahead with retiring the Larkspur product line by end of next fiscal year. Demand has drifted to the Meridell range, and keeping both alive is eating support capacity. Customer comms go out in phases; Tomas is drafting the migration offer. Expect a few noisy accounts in the Calderbay region, but nothing we can't manage. The confidential plan behind this decision follows below.

internal memo for kagef-tahof: Kasixek Foods plans to lower the Kasix list price by 31 percent in February.

## Q3 Planning Note: Annual Billing Shift

Heads up, team — starting next quarter we're nudging Lanternsoft customers from monthly to annual billing. Expect a short-term dip in reported monthly revenue, offset by much better cash position and lower churn. Ops will handle migration comms; finance is updating the forecast templates. Keep your budget asks realistic until the transition settles. Context on the bigger picture follows below.

board note of kageg-bahof: The renewal with Holwynax Holdings closes at $2 million a year, 5 percent below the last contract. Project Ulaath slips by two quarters because of the supplier delay.

Runbook: FareLogic rules engine. Shipping fee rules load from the Tarn cluster at boot; a stale cache means wrong zone surcharges. To reload: restart the fee-eval pod, confirm rule version in /status, verify against the Meldport test cart. Rules older than 24h trigger an alert. The engine reads its upstream credential from .env.fees; the following line must be present there before restart.

vault entry, yahif-yajep: COURIER_KEY29=b802bdf8034096b65a51c6ba5abe2